The Producer’s role is to ensure that all aspects of a program are successfully delivered to the client.  The Producer is also responsible for the fiscal health of the program and for communicating effectively with the team and the client.  It is essential that the candidate for this position has the 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ously and must possess excellent communication and organizational skills. You’ll help reverse engineer creative ideas to bring them to physical life; as such, an understanding of business strategy, engineering, and technical savvy will come in handy.

From brief to wrap, you’ll be:

Directing and tracking project budgets, deadlines, invoices, estimates, purchase requests and billing.

Developing and maintaining positive client, vendor and external agency relationships, ensuring that all needs are heard, understood and addressed in a timely way.

Working with Account Management to guide the development, writing and support presentation of proposals, SOWs, schedules, financials and staffing plans.

Working with the Production Director, Account Director and Creative Director to manage the program process from creative through execution.

Planning and participating in team meetings and managing communications between team members, ensuring all deadlines are met and opportunities are identified to share project resources.

Developing, communicating and managing event schedules and logistic planning.

Managing resources; identify, participate in negotiation and secure external resources as needed.

Participating in creative brainstorms to generate ideas for clients; continually looking for innovative solutions and production methods.

Ideal candidates:

Extensive previous experience with Production Management and Consumer Events.

Demonstrated production competencies: build experience, fabrication understanding, ability to read drawings, estimate creation, client focus, accountability for results, team effectiveness, developing other team members, attention to detail, flexibility and professional confidence.

Strong familiarity and comfort with technology in general, a desire to remain informed of current trends and improvements.
